Nitrogen doping is a method used to enhance the properties of graphene. When nitrogen is introduced into the graphene lattice, it alters the structure and functionality of the carbon and changes its chemical nature.

1. Effect on Optical Bandgap: Generally, introducing nitrogen atoms into the graphene structure can increase the optical bandgap. This is due to the increase in electron deficiency in the lattice caused by the nitrogen atom’s fewer valence electrons compared to carbon. As a result, the energy required for an electron to jump from the valence band to the conduction band increases, leading to an increased optical bandgap. Moreover, the degree of this effect depends on the amount, type (e.g., pyridinic N, pyrrolic N, or graphitic N), and position of nitrogen dopants in the graphene lattice.

2. Effect on Electrical Conductivity: Nitrogen doping can also improve the electrical conductivity of graphene. This improved electrical conductivity is attributed to the fact that nitrogen doping introduces extra charge carriers (i.e., more free electrons) into the graphene network, which can move freely and contribute to electrical conductivity. Furthermore, the extent of conductivity enhancement is strongly influenced by the nitrogen-doping level and the method used for nitrogen doping.

To keep in mind, while these are general trends, the specific effects of nitrogen doping may vary depending on the experimental conditions, the type of graphene used, and the specific methods of doping and characterization used.
